TEST PRINCIPLE
This ELISA kit uses the Sandwich-ELISA principle. The micro ELISA plate provided in this kit has been pre-coated with an antibody specific to Monkey MASP2. Standards or samples are added to the micro ELISA plate wells and combined with the specific antibody. Then a biotinylated detection antibody specific for Monkey MASP2 and Avidin-Horseradish Peroxidase (HRP) conjugate are added successively to each micro plate well and incubated. Free components are washed away. The substrate solution is added to each well. Only those wells that contain Monkey MASP2, biotinylated detection antibody and Avidin-HRP conjugate will appear blue in color. The enzyme-substrate reaction is terminated by the addition of stop solution and the color turns yellow. The optical density (OD) is measured spectrophotometrically at a wavelength of 450 nm ± 2 nm. The OD value is proportional to the concentration of Monkey MASP2. You can calculate the concentration of Monkey MASP2 in the samples by comparing the OD of the samples to the standard curve. |

PRECISION
Intra-Assay Precision (Precision within an assay): Three samples of known concentration were tested twenty times on one plate to assess intra-assay precision.
Inter-Assay Precision (Precision between assays): Three samples of known concentration were tested in twenty separate assays to assess inter-assay precision. Assays were performed by at least three technicians using two lots of components.
Intra-assay Precision | Inter-assay Precision |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Sample | 1 | 2 | 3 | 1 | 2 | 3 |
n | 20 | 20 | 20 | 20 | 20 | 20 |
Mean (ng/mL) | 0.96 | 2.17 | 8.32 | 0.91 | 2.32 | 7.57 |
Standard deviation | 0.05 | 0.1 | 0.41 | 0.06 | 0.11 | 0.4 |
CV(%) | 5.55 | 4.46 | 4.93 | 6.39 | 4.64 | 5.22 |
RECOVERY
The recovery of Monkey MASP2 spiked to three different levels in samples throughout the range of the assay in various matrices was evaluated.
Sample Type | Range (%) | Average Recovery (%) |
---|---|---|
Serum(n=8) | 92-107 | 99 |
EDTA plasma (n=8) | 96-107 | 101 |
Cell culture media (n=8) | 95-112 | 102 |
